Biological function summary
Orai3 plays an essential role in cellular calcium signaling important for various cell functions such as gene expression secretion and metabolism. It often combines with other subunits of the Orai family like Orai1 to form functional calcium channels. Orai3 may form different channel complexes affecting the amplitude and kinetics of calcium entry. Its presence ensures that cells can adapt to specific physiological contexts where calcium influx is required.
Pathways
Orai3 is a significant part of the store-operated calcium entry (SOCE) pathway which activates when intracellular calcium stores get depleted. This pathway is important for maintaining cellular calcium and proteins like STIM1 work closely with Orai3 to initiate calcium influx. The interplay between STIM1 and Orai3 ensures proper signal transduction essential for processes like T-cell activation and other immune responses.
